Transaction 64a62b21e204788715e66e4f6459de0a90b29bf5f27ec3eda891b3fc300e0eb5

1 Input
2 Outputs
  • 64a62b21e204788715e66e4f6459de0a90b29bf5f27ec3eda891b3fc300e0eb5:0
  • value  890700
    address  158Zt2bQvjk4xr8BNJqyDM2TLzsxk4wXba
  • 64a62b21e204788715e66e4f6459de0a90b29bf5f27ec3eda891b3fc300e0eb5:1
  • value  650000
    address  1KJGQNUCsKPXjN3TZggu1Fr3sza7qvUGYo